[DynInst_API:] [dyninst/dyninst] 9efb68: aarch64 - fix missing returns in AliasMap functions


Date: Fri, 22 Nov 2024 12:56:18 -0800
From: Tim Haines <noreply@xxxxxxxxxx>
Subject: [DynInst_API:] [dyninst/dyninst] 9efb68: aarch64 - fix missing returns in AliasMap functions
  Branch: refs/heads/thaines/cleanup_InstructionDecoder_classes
  Home:   https://github.com/dyninst/dyninst
  Commit: 9efb6828b0a2667528f45c5819712789af839c5a
      https://github.com/dyninst/dyninst/commit/9efb6828b0a2667528f45c5819712789af839c5a
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-aarch64.C

  Log Message:
  -----------
  aarch64 - fix missing returns in AliasMap functions


  Commit: 59b30529a9353762e1f9f665ce0773095657dddd
      https://github.com/dyninst/dyninst/commit/59b30529a9353762e1f9f665ce0773095657dddd
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-aarch64.C
    M instructionAPI/src/InstructionDecoder-aarch64.h

  Log Message:
  -----------
  aarch64 - move macros into source file


  Commit: 8242b09c76a9f7c9a0ffc09a214c7d22716e3543
      https://github.com/dyninst/dyninst/commit/8242b09c76a9f7c9a0ffc09a214c7d22716e3543
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-aarch64.C
    M instructionAPI/src/InstructionDecoder-aarch64.h

  Log Message:
  -----------
  aarch64 - remove dead debug macros


  Commit: 1630278977b78cd1b5f52995bc287950df4ad44a
      https://github.com/dyninst/dyninst/commit/1630278977b78cd1b5f52995bc287950df4ad44a
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-aarch64.C

  Log Message:
  -----------
  aarch64 - parenthesize bitwise operations in 'if' expression.


  Commit: 91c0c1fbfb19d8d5f577a8f2b7de20fa1fea20f7
      https://github.com/dyninst/dyninst/commit/91c0c1fbfb19d8d5f577a8f2b7de20fa1fea20f7
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-aarch64.C
    M instructionAPI/src/InstructionDecoder-aarch64.h

  Log Message:
  -----------
  aarch64 - whitespace


  Commit: 2ca7efd7194825c6e53283e764316cc42bc8c849
      https://github.com/dyninst/dyninst/commit/2ca7efd7194825c6e53283e764316cc42bc8c849
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-power.C
    M instructionAPI/src/InstructionDecoder-power.h

  Log Message:
  -----------
  ppc - remove dead debug macros


  Commit: 62282170bc9b292c89c12fbe1891d5b3f9d9572f
      https://github.com/dyninst/dyninst/commit/62282170bc9b292c89c12fbe1891d5b3f9d9572f
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-power.C
    M instructionAPI/src/InstructionDecoder-power.h

  Log Message:
  -----------
  ppc - whitespace


  Commit: ba4e4034c5b0baaf1a311ef34122affcea14cff6
      https://github.com/dyninst/dyninst/commit/ba4e4034c5b0baaf1a311ef34122affcea14cff6
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-x86.h

  Log Message:
  -----------
  x86 - remove redundant doc comments

They are already in the actual documentation.


  Commit: 103ced08499cc1152bff3406927294eb9e7f1fac
      https://github.com/dyninst/dyninst/commit/103ced08499cc1152bff3406927294eb9e7f1fac
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-x86.C
    M instructionAPI/src/InstructionDecoder-x86.h

  Log Message:
  -----------
  x86 - remove dead macros


  Commit: 9f714f4be370713829f1ca9b4e562db7678a2502
      https://github.com/dyninst/dyninst/commit/9f714f4be370713829f1ca9b4e562db7678a2502
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/src/InstructionDecoder-x86.C
    M instructionAPI/src/InstructionDecoder-x86.h

  Log Message:
  -----------
  x86 - whitespace


  Commit: 1dc1f0cc67a3bb8890f7aee43fe053c77d93024a
      https://github.com/dyninst/dyninst/commit/1dc1f0cc67a3bb8890f7aee43fe053c77d93024a
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/doc/API/InstructionDecoder.tex
    M instructionAPI/h/InstructionDecoder.h

  Log Message:
  -----------
  InstructionDecoder - move comments into the documentation


  Commit: 47d1d2df0283df0c7df3e3f7acb38561798f2918
      https://github.com/dyninst/dyninst/commit/47d1d2df0283df0c7df3e3f7acb38561798f2918
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/InstructionDecoder.h
    M instructionAPI/src/InstructionDecoder.C

  Log Message:
  -----------
  InstructionDecoder - whitespace


  Commit: f56f55ae8dd2d0e0e87e19e67e89b727a2c243f9
      https://github.com/dyninst/dyninst/commit/f56f55ae8dd2d0e0e87e19e67e89b727a2c243f9
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/doc/API/BinaryFunction.tex
    M instructionAPI/h/BinaryFunction.h

  Log Message:
  -----------
  BinaryFunction - remove redundant docs


  Commit: 17d411bd2bb26e3716d1cfcc4a9a55111fcba9f1
      https://github.com/dyninst/dyninst/commit/17d411bd2bb26e3716d1cfcc4a9a55111fcba9f1
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/BinaryFunction.h
    M instructionAPI/src/BinaryFunction.C

  Log Message:
  -----------
  BinaryFunction - whitespace


  Commit: 5b2a264e76f906770d69fa0dffab77a1ff79f789
      https://github.com/dyninst/dyninst/commit/5b2a264e76f906770d69fa0dffab77a1ff79f789
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/doc/API/Dereference.tex
    M instructionAPI/h/Dereference.h

  Log Message:
  -----------
  Dereference - clean up docs


  Commit: dd3465055e67935f1ec045fb7d22d5e664c7b94e
      https://github.com/dyninst/dyninst/commit/dd3465055e67935f1ec045fb7d22d5e664c7b94e
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Dereference.h

  Log Message:
  -----------
  Dereference - remove dead debug macros


  Commit: a2c2284dfd894f3722dec66021d1bd5519ecb9e0
      https://github.com/dyninst/dyninst/commit/a2c2284dfd894f3722dec66021d1bd5519ecb9e0
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Dereference.h

  Log Message:
  -----------
  Dereference - whitespace


  Commit: 5ae0bedd2c07ece27e5914b85a9fe4e8cf6990f7
      https://github.com/dyninst/dyninst/commit/5ae0bedd2c07ece27e5914b85a9fe4e8cf6990f7
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/doc/API/Expression.tex
    M instructionAPI/h/Expression.h
    M instructionAPI/src/Expression.C

  Log Message:
  -----------
  Expression - clean up docs


  Commit: 2b939c7c321752e08d0ad61a738f3095dbefb157
      https://github.com/dyninst/dyninst/commit/2b939c7c321752e08d0ad61a738f3095dbefb157
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Expression.h
    M instructionAPI/src/Expression.C

  Log Message:
  -----------
  Expression - whitespace


  Commit: 685a25d3966aba6463b27426da5f6a31bb0acaec
      https://github.com/dyninst/dyninst/commit/685a25d3966aba6463b27426da5f6a31bb0acaec
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Immediate.h

  Log Message:
  -----------
  Immediate - clean up docs


  Commit: da6ba0cc0e304be5d2d5c01246a0348e71f1163c
      https://github.com/dyninst/dyninst/commit/da6ba0cc0e304be5d2d5c01246a0348e71f1163c
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Immediate.h
    M instructionAPI/src/Immediate.C

  Log Message:
  -----------
  Immediate - whitespace


  Commit: f1523cb7a6545b881a4c6c63d556b69158b5fc6c
      https://github.com/dyninst/dyninst/commit/f1523cb7a6545b881a4c6c63d556b69158b5fc6c
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/InstructionAST.h

  Log Message:
  -----------
  InstructionAST - clean up docs


  Commit: 13e2a882fd7b460ad4cb472a9803ffdd4c18633a
      https://github.com/dyninst/dyninst/commit/13e2a882fd7b460ad4cb472a9803ffdd4c18633a
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/InstructionAST.h
    M instructionAPI/src/InstructionAST.C

  Log Message:
  -----------
  InstructionAST - whitespace


  Commit: 19643654bc66ef239c37c39220555ef9cc2d6c16
      https://github.com/dyninst/dyninst/commit/19643654bc66ef239c37c39220555ef9cc2d6c16
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/MultiRegister.h

  Log Message:
  -----------
  MultiRegisterAST - update docs


  Commit: 1dec9e60e73f5947b2c07f228dc17274e5ee5162
      https://github.com/dyninst/dyninst/commit/1dec9e60e73f5947b2c07f228dc17274e5ee5162
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    A instructionAPI/doc/API/MultiRegisterAST.tex
    M instructionAPI/h/MultiRegister.h
    M instructionAPI/src/MultiRegister.C

  Log Message:
  -----------
  MultiRegisterAST - whitespace


  Commit: c92602644e2245356cf435855c3d3429228662cd
      https://github.com/dyninst/dyninst/commit/c92602644e2245356cf435855c3d3429228662cd
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/doc/API/RegisterAST.tex
    M instructionAPI/h/Register.h

  Log Message:
  -----------
  RegisterAST - update docs


  Commit: a898c2161e1c0517fdeb3373d374250ff2110cdb
      https://github.com/dyninst/dyninst/commit/a898c2161e1c0517fdeb3373d374250ff2110cdb
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Register.h
    M instructionAPI/src/Register.C

  Log Message:
  -----------
  RegisterAST - whitespace


  Commit: 6b60c859640260da60e54bb6b2d152565bed17d9
      https://github.com/dyninst/dyninst/commit/6b60c859640260da60e54bb6b2d152565bed17d9
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Ternary.h

  Log Message:
  -----------
  TernaryAST - update docs


  Commit: f783ce6274a993e519438602880aa77f5d1bc84b
      https://github.com/dyninst/dyninst/commit/f783ce6274a993e519438602880aa77f5d1bc84b
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Ternary.h
    M instructionAPI/src/Ternary.C

  Log Message:
  -----------
  TernaryAST - whitespace


  Commit: 02f1a24faf3bebb3b654860bfa3ae9b3680d6d9f
      https://github.com/dyninst/dyninst/commit/02f1a24faf3bebb3b654860bfa3ae9b3680d6d9f
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    A instructionAPI/doc/API/TernaryAST.tex
    M instructionAPI/doc/API/Visitor.tex
    M instructionAPI/h/Visitor.h

  Log Message:
  -----------
  Visitor - update docs


  Commit: 13b12dc15dc6c28f771c1adbdc25e8b2faca33af
      https://github.com/dyninst/dyninst/commit/13b12dc15dc6c28f771c1adbdc25e8b2faca33af
  Author: Tim Haines <thaines.astro@xxxxxxxxx>
  Date:   2024-11-22 (Fri, 22 Nov 2024)

  Changed paths:
    M instructionAPI/h/Visitor.h

  Log Message:
  -----------
  Visitor - whitespace


Compare: https://github.com/dyninst/dyninst/compare/9efb6828b0a2%5E...13b12dc15dc6

To unsubscribe from these emails, change your notification settings at https://github.com/dyninst/dyninst/settings/notifications
[← Prev in Thread] Current Thread [Next in Thread→]
  • [DynInst_API:] [dyninst/dyninst] 9efb68: aarch64 - fix missing returns in AliasMap functions, Tim Haines <=